genetic problems: monohybrid
for each of the following problems:
a. make a key
b. write out the cross
c. make a punnett square
d. give the resulting genotypes, phenotypes and ratios for both
you must do this for every cross in each question!
- in pea plants, red flower (r) color is dominant over white (r). cross a red purebred with a white purebred.
- in pea plants, red flower color is dominant over white. cross a hybrid red with a white.
- in wheat plants, tall stalks (t) are dominant over short stalks (t). cross a homozygous dominant with a heterozygous.
- in humans, brown hair color is dominant over blonde. cross a true-breeding brown haired woman with a true-breeding blonde haired man, then cross the f₁ hybrids to get the f₂ results.

Problem 4:
F₁ Generation:
- Key: Brown hair (dominant) = $B$, Blonde hair (recessive) = $b$
- Cross: $BB$ × $bb$
- Genotypes: 100% $Bb$
- Phenotypes: 100% brown hair
F₂ Generation:
- Cross: $Bb$ × $Bb$
- Genotypes: 1:2:1 ratio of $BB$ : $Bb$ : $bb$
- Phenotypes: 3:1 ratio of brown hair to blonde hair
